# Environment Variables — Sweepline Retention Service

Sweepline deletes records past their retention window on a nightly schedule. `SWEEP_WINDOW_DAYS` controls the cutoff; `SWEEP_DRY_RUN` should be `true` on first deploy to any environment. Batch size defaults to 5,000 and rarely needs tuning. All variables are read once at startup, so changes require a restart. The purge API also requires an authentication secret, set via the following line in the environment file:

env line for yahag-kajog: VAULT_KEY13=e1c568d90102d

Briefing: Loyalty Programme Overhaul — Board Review

The Meridale Rewards scheme will be replaced with a tiered points model in Q3. Redemption costs fall by an estimated 12%, and enrolment friction drops with automatic sign-up at checkout. Pilot results in the Halverton region exceeded targets. Full rollout requires board sign-off by month end. The following note outlines the commercial rationale.

board note of bawep-tajef: Queniusek Systems plans to raise the Quenvan list price by 53.1 percent in March. The pricing group signed off on a budget of $176.4 million for Project Drueth. The renewal with Casionix Partners closes at $142.5 million a year, 8.3 percent below the last contract. Project Fraax slips by six weeks because of the tooling delay.

**Guest Wi-Fi — Contractor Instructions**

All contractors visiting Orvane Works must collect Wi-Fi credentials from the guest desk at reception. No personal hotspots on site. Bring photo ID; credentials expire daily at 19:00. Do not share logins between crew members. The desk is staffed 08:00–17:30; outside those hours, see security. To enter the reception annexe where the desk sits, key in the code below.

turnstile pass: bdg-NG-3